The dimensional forumla for thermal resistance is

A

`[ML^2T^(-3) K^(-1)]`

B

`[ML^2 T^(-2) A^(-1)]`

C

`[M^(-1) L^(-2) T^3 K]`

D

`[ML^2 T^(-3) K^(-2)]`

To find the dimensional formula for thermal resistance, we start with the relationship that defines thermal resistance: 1. **Understanding Thermal Resistance**: Thermal resistance (R) is defined as the temperature difference (ΔT) divided by the rate of heat flow (Q). Mathematically, this can be expressed as: \[ R = \frac{\Delta T}{Q} \] 2. **Identifying the Dimensions**: - **Temperature Difference (ΔT)**: The dimension of temperature is represented as [K] (Kelvin). - **Rate of Heat Flow (Q)**: The rate of heat flow can be understood as energy per unit time. The dimension of energy is given by the formula: \[ [E] = [M][L^2][T^{-2}] \] where [M] is mass, [L] is length, and [T] is time. Therefore, the dimension of heat flow per unit time (Q) is: \[ [Q] = \frac{[E]}{[T]} = \frac{[M][L^2][T^{-2}]}{[T]} = [M][L^2][T^{-3}] \] 3. **Combining the Dimensions**: Now, substituting the dimensions of ΔT and Q into the formula for thermal resistance: \[ R = \frac{[K]}{[M][L^2][T^{-3}]} \] This can be rewritten as: \[ R = [K][M^{-1}][L^{-2}][T^{3}] \] 4. **Final Dimensional Formula**: Therefore, the dimensional formula for thermal resistance is: \[ R = [M^{-1}][L^{-2}][K][T^{3}] \] Thus, the final answer is: \[ \text{Dimensional Formula of Thermal Resistance} = M^{-1}L^{-2}K^{1}T^{3} \]
